تفاوت cms رایگان و اختصاصی

تفاوت cms رایگان و اختصاصی

سیستم مدیریت محتوا چیست ؟
سیستم مدیریت محتوا ، یا content management system یا CMS است ، که سیستم نرم افزاری ای است که به کمک آن  به مدیریت محتوا  پرداخته می شود و نظام قابل مدیریتی را در ثبت ،  بروزرسانی و بازیابی محتوا فراهم می کند.

در کشور ما ایران ، به خاطر گسترش این شاخه از نرم افزارهای سیستم مدیریت محتوا ، عبارت cms تنها به نرم افزارهای مدیریت وب سایت اطلاق می شود در حالیکه این نرم افزارها الزاما وابسته به وب نیستند و برنامه های کاربردی مدیریت محتوای وب سایت های اینترنتی صرفا یک نمونه از این گونه سیستم های مدیریت محتوا می باشد.
قبلا ها  سیستم طراحی سایت کاملاً ساده و استاتیک بود . استاتیک یعنی  فقط کسایی که به کد نویسی آشنایی داشتن میتونستند سایت رو ویرایش کنند . مثلا اگر میخواستید شماره تلفن خودتون رو داخل سایت ویرایش کنید باید به طراح سایت زنگ میزدید و ازش میخواستید این کار را برایتان انجام بده .!!
بعد ها سیستمی درست کردن  که کاربر بتواند  این جور ویرایش ها را به راحتی انجام بدهد. بنابراین  سیستم های مدیریت محتوا یا CMS بوجود آمدند و همینطور پیشرفت کردند تا به امروز . شما حتی میتوانید براحتی به سایتتون امکانات اضافه کنید بدون اینکه کد نویسی نیاز باشه . 
اگر بخوایم در قالب مثال توضیح بدیم یک CMS چهارچوب یک ساختمون است . یک سیستم کاملاً آماده برای هر نوع تغییرات ظاهری . شما هیچ محدودیتی در ایجاد تغییرات ظاهری و امکانات ندارید . گرچه ممکن است برای ایجاد یک سری از امکانات تغییراتی رو در چهارچوب ساختمون ایجاد کنید ولی قطعاً این کار شدنیه و مشکلی در این خصوص ندارید . پس سیستم مدیریت محتوا هیچ محدودیتی ایجاد نمیکنه .
انواع سیستم مدیریت محتوا:
سیستم های رایگان مثل وردپرس ، جوملا ، دروپال . . . بصورت متن باز و رایگان در اختیار کاربران قرار گرفتند و هر کسی میتواند این کدها را تغییر بدهدو ازآنها استفاده کند . البته هرکدام مزایا و معایبی دارند که در ادامه بهشان اشاره خواهیم کرد.
اما در مقابل شرکت های بزرگ و معتبر طراحی سایت با سرمایه گذاری در این زمینه و تشکیل تیم تخصصی اقدام به طراحی CMS اختصاصی با برند خود نموده و به مشتریانشان ارائه مینمایند. لذا هزینه سیستم اختصاصی در مقایسه با سیستم های عمومی بالاتر میباشد. اما جدا از بحث هزینه، مزایای فراوانی سیستم های اختصاصی در مقایسه با سیستم های عمومی دارند که در ادامه به آن اشاره میشود.
وردپرس چیست ؟
وردپرس یک سی ام اس یا سیستم مدیریت محتوای متن باز میباشد ، این سیستم که در ابتدا یک سیستم مدیریت وبلاگ ساده بود ، بعد ها به صورت یک سی ام اس یا سیستم مدیریت محتوا در اختیار عموم قرار گرفت.شما میتوانید وردپرس را به صورت رایگان نصب کرده و وبسایت خود را به وسیله آن راه اندازی نماییدراه اندازی وبسایت با ورد پرس آسان بوده و شما میتوانید با چند کلیک وبسایت های خود را اعم از شرکتی ، فروشگاهی و غیره راه اندازی نمایید و در ادامه و آینده به توسعه آن بپردازید.
وردپرس جزو سی ام اس های آماده سایت ساز محسوب میشود و به جز وردپرس سی ام های دیگری هستند که میتوان با آنها طراحی سایت انجام داد.
این سیستم دارای پنل های مدیریت به زبان های مختلف میباشد.
متن باز بودن این سی ام اس باعث شده که برنامه نویسان مختلف از سراسر دنیا بتوانند به توسعه این سیستم بپردازند که البته همین موضوع باعث نا امنی وحشتناک این سی ام اس شده است. امنیت این ماژول ها از هیچ طریقی تایید نمیشوند و استفاده از آنها به نوعی ریسک محسوب میشود. ( به استثنای ماژول های رسمی وردپرس)به طور کلی وردپرس و سایر سیستم های سایت ساز آماده و متن باز بیشتر جهت طراحی سایت هایی با امکانات محدود و با درجه اهمیت پایین استفاده میشوند. کمتر سایت دانشگاهی ، سایت فروشگاهی حرفه ای یا سایت ایده محوری را میبینید که با سایت ساز های آماده طراحی شده باشند.
برخی از مزایای استفاده از CMSها ی رایگان
1. هزینه راه اندازی اولیه کمتر است.
البته علی‌رغم اینکه این سیستم‌ها اغلب رایگان هستند و یا هزینه اندکی دارند، گاها دیده شده برخی شرکت‌های طراحی سایت با توجه به عدم آشنایی کارفرما با جزئیات کار، مبالغ بیشتری نسبت به طراحی اختصاصی برای پیاده‌سازی سیستم مدیریت محتوای آماده از کارفرما دریافت نموده‌اند.
2.زمان راه اندازی اولیه کمتر.
3.امکان راه اندازی سایت (هر چند غیر حرفه‌ای) برای عموم و غیر متخصصین.
 برخی از معایب استفاده از CMSهای رایگان 
1. اعمال تغییرات بنیادین و اضافه نمودن قابلیت‌های جدید که در حیطه سیستم تعریف نشده باشد بسیار سخت است.
2. عموما هسته نرم افزاری اصلی سایت بسیار سنگین است و سایت هر چند هم که امکانات مختصری داشته باشد باز سرعت لود کمی دارد چرا که باید موتور محرک سایت کاملا بارگذاری شود. همچنین در هنگام استفاده از سایت، منابع سخت افزاری تا حد زیادی مورد استفاده قرار می‌گیرند.
3. با توجه به اینکه سورس کدهای برنامه و متدلوژی برنامه‌نویسی در اختیار عموم برنامه‌نویسان قرار دارد، سیستم از لحاظ امنیتی در خطر بیشتری قرار دارد. این مساله در نسخه‌های قدیمی جوملا بسیار دیده می‌شود. هر از چند گاهی نیز باگ‌های امنیتی و همچنین راه‌حل و بسته‌های امنیتی توسط برنامه‌نویسان سیستم‌های مدیریت محتوی بر روی اینترنت قرار می‌گیرد که اگر مدیران سایت به سرعت آن را بر روی سایت خود اعمال نکنند احتمال بروز مشکل امنیتی به مراتب بیشتر خواهد شد.
4. اکثر سیستم های مدیریت محتوی به لحاظ مباحث بهینه سازی سایت برای موتورهای جستجو ضعیف عمل کرده اند. این مشکل در جوملا بسیار پررنگ تر است و در وردپرس کمتر دیده می‌شود.
5. مسئول محتوی سایت (ادمین سایت) این امکان را در پنل مدیریت دارد تا در چیدمان اجزا و گرافیک سایت تغییرات ایجاد کند و همچنین امکانات سایت را نیز حذف و اضافه نماید یا مورد تغییر قرار دهد. این مساله از دو جهت می‌تواند تاثیر منفی بگذارد. هم ممکن است باعث شود کاربری پنل مدیریت برای ادمین سایت سخت شود چرا که ممکن است در میان امکانات زیاد سردرگم شود. و مشکل دیگر اینکه با توجه به اینکه عموما ادمین سایت نسبت به اصول طراحی سایت و معماری اطلاعات و کاربردپذیری اطلاعات کمتری نسبت به طراح حرفه‌ای سایت دارد، اعمال تغییرات توسط وی در سایت، باعث خارج‌ شدن سایت از حالت استاندارد می‌شود و منجر به کاهش جذابیت و همچنین سخت شدن امکان استفاده از سایت توسط بازدیدکنندگان می‌شود.
اما در مقابل شرکت های بزرگ و معتبر طراحی سایت با سرمایه گذاری در این زمینه و تشکیل تیم تخصصی اقدام به طراحی CMS اختصاصی با برند خود نموده و به مشتریانشان ارائه مینمایند. لذا هزینه سیستم اختصاصی در مقایسه با سیستم های عمومی بالاتر میباشد. اما جدا از بحث هزینه، مزایای فراوانی سیستم های اختصاصی در مقایسه با سیستم های عمومی دارند که در ادامه به آن اشاره میشود:
مزایای طراحی و پیاده‌سازی سایت اختصاصی
1. طراحی گرافیکی می‌تواند خاص و خلاقانه باشد و محدویت قالب وجود ندارد.
قالب گرافیکی سایت که اهمیت زیادی در موفقیت سایت دارد در این شیوه می‌تواند بسیار خاص و خلاقانه و با استفاده از به‌روزترین تکنولوژی‌ها طراحی و پیاده‌سازی شود چرا که با توجه به اختصاصی بودن برنامه نویسی امکان تطابق با امکانات سایت را خواهد داشت.
2. امکانات نرم افزاری سایت دقیقا منطبق با نیاز کارفرما است.
با توجه به اینکه سایت از ابتدا بر اساس نیاز و توضیحات کارفرما برنامه‌نویسی و پیاده‌سازی می‌گردد، تمامی بخش‌های داینامیک سایت اعم از فرم‌ها، سناریوهای فروش آنلاین، معرفی محصولات و ... کاملا اختصاصی و متناسب با تقاضای کارفرما پیاده‌سازی می‌گردد.
3. سایت سریع است و صفحات آن سبک و بهینه هستند.
در هنگام طراحی اختصاصی، سایت هسته مرکزی معمولا سبکی دارد و سایت فقط به میزان قابلیت‌ها و امکانات موجود از منابع سخت افزاری استفاده می‌کند و برعکس CMS هسته مرکزی سنگینی ندارد.
4. در طول زمان، امکان اعمال تغییرات و اضافه نمودن قابلیت‌های خاص و جدید ساده‌تر است چرا که برنامه‌نویس سیستم کاملا بر روی تمام اجزای سایت احاطه دارد و می‌تواند تغییرات عمده ایجاد نماید و بنا بر نظر کارفرما امکانات خاص به سایت اضافه نماید.
5. امنیت بیشتری دارد چرا که کدهای نرم‌افزار و متدلوژی برنامه نویسی و پیاده‌سازی خصوصی است و در اختیار عموم قرار ندارد.
6.  کنترل پنل ساده‌تری دارد چون بیشتر با هدف مدیریت محتوای سایت در اختیار ادمین قرار می‌گیرد و نه مدیریت امکانات و قابلیت‌ها و چیدمان سایت.
7. تمام مبانی بهینه سازی رتبه سایت برای موتورهای جستجو یا در واقع SEO می‌تواند در هنگام پیاده‌سازی سایت اختصاصی لحاظ شود و از منظر فنی عملکرد سایت را در زمینه ارتقاء رتبه سایت برای جستجوگرها تضمین نماید.
8. امکانات نرم‌افزاری و چیدمان اجزای سایت حرفه‌ای تر هستند چرا که توسط متخصص انجام می‌شوند.
معایب طراحی و پیاده‌سازی سایت اختصاصی
1. معمولا هزینه اولیه بیشتری نسبت به سیستم‌های آماده دارد.
2. زمان راه‌اندازی اولیه تا حدودی نسبت به سیستم‌های آماده بیشتر است.
3. سایت در اکثر موارد فقط توسط تیم اولیه طراح سایت پشتیبانی می‌شود و قابلیت انتقال به شرکت دیگری برای پشتیبانی ندارد. اگر هم منتقل شود این پروسه عموما سخت انجام می‌شود.
 

نوشتن نظر







وبلاگ گروه آرتین

ارائه مطالب مفید و سودمند در زمینه طراحی سایت ، بازاریابی اینترنتی و بهینه سازی موتورهای جستجو (SEO)

مشاوره آنلاین
مشاوره آنلاین
تیم پشتیبانی مشتریان
درباره گروه فناوران آرتین

گروه فناوران آرتین با یک تیم با تجربه ، خدماتی چون طراحی سایت ، طراحی سیستم های اختصاصی تحت وب و تحت ویندوز و بهینه سازی سایت را بر اساس نیاز و سلیقه مشتریان ارائه می کند . این شرکت با بهره گیری از دانش و تکنولوژی های جدید برنامه نویسی توانسته با همت و پشتکار خود سیستم های پر قدرت و حرفه ای تحت وب همچون فروشگاهی ، شرکتی ، سازمانی ، صنعتی و سیستم های اختصاصی مورد نیاز کارخانجات را تولید و به عرصه فروش